How to Care for Your Skin for a Healthy Glow

Posted on October 14, 2025

Taking care of your skin is essential for maintaining its health and appearance. Your skin acts as a barrier protecting you from environmental damage, but it also reflects your overall well-being. Developing a simple yet effective skincare routine can help you achieve a radiant complexion and prevent common problems like dryness, acne, and premature aging.

Understanding your skin type is the foundation of good skincare. Skin types generally fall into five categories: normal, oily, dry, combination, and sensitive. Knowing your skin type helps you select products that work best for you. For example, oily skin benefits from lightweight, non-comedogenic products that prevent clogged pores, while dry skin needs rich, nourishing creams to restore moisture. Sensitive skin requires gentle formulations free from harsh chemicals and fragrances.

Cleansing is the first and most crucial step in any skincare routine. It removes dirt, sweat, makeup, and excess oils that accumulate on your skin throughout the day. Cleansing twice daily, morning and night, keeps pores clean and prevents breakouts. Avoid harsh soaps that strip the skin’s natural oils, as this can cause irritation and imbalance.

Moisturizing follows cleansing and is important for all skin types. A good moisturizer maintains hydration and strengthens the skin’s protective barrier. Even oily skin needs moisturizing to prevent the skin from producing excess oil due to dehydration. Look for ingredients like hyaluronic acid, glycerin, and ceramides, which help lock in moisture and improve skin texture. For daytime, lightweight moisturizers with SPF are perfect, while heavier creams are better suited for nighttime use.

Protecting your skin from sun damage is vital. Ultraviolet (UV) rays cause premature aging, dark spots, and increase the risk of skin cancer. Wearing sunscreen every day, regardless of weather or season, shields your skin from harmful rays. Opt for broad-spectrum sunscreens with at least SPF 30. Apply it generously on all exposed areas, and reapply every two hours if you’re spending extended time outdoors. Sunscreen not only prevents damage but also helps maintain an even skin tone.

Exfoliation is another beneficial practice but should be done with care. It removes dead skin cells that can clog pores and make your skin look dull. There are two types of exfoliants: physical exfoliants, which use small particles to scrub away dead skin, and chemical exfoliants, which use acids like AHAs or BHAs to dissolve dead cells. Limit exfoliation to one or two times a week to avoid irritation. Over-exfoliating can weaken the skin’s barrier, causing redness and sensitivity.

Healthy skin also depends on your lifestyle choices. Drinking plenty of water helps keep your skin hydrated from within. Eating a balanced diet rich in antioxidants, vitamins, and healthy fats supports skin repair and combats inflammation. Foods like berries, leafy greens, nuts, and fish are excellent for skin health. Additionally, getting adequate sleep allows your skin to rejuvenate and repair itself overnight, reducing puffiness and dark circles.

Stress management plays a role in skin condition too. High stress levels can trigger breakouts and worsen conditions like eczema or psoriasis. Incorporating relaxation techniques such as meditation, exercise, or hobbies can improve both your skin and overall well-being.

Maintaining hygiene is also important. Avoid touching your face unnecessarily, as your hands carry bacteria that can cause breakouts. Wash your pillowcases, towels, and makeup brushes regularly to reduce the risk of irritation and infection.

If you face persistent skin problems like acne, redness, or dryness that don’t improve with basic care, consulting a dermatologist is advisable. Professionals can provide tailored treatments and advice suited to your skin’s needs.

In conclusion, caring for your skin requires a combination of consistent daily habits, suitable products, and a healthy lifestyle. By understanding your skin type, cleansing and moisturizing properly, protecting yourself from the sun, and making mindful lifestyle choices, you can enjoy healthy, glowing skin for years to come. Remember, patience and regular care are the keys to lasting results.
